Sever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2(SARS-CoV-2) infection during late pregnancy: a report of 18 patients from Wuhan, China.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

Compared with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ome (SARS) and Middle East Respiratory Syndrome (MERS), Corona Virus Disease 2019(COVID-19) spread more rapidly and widely. The population was generally susceptible. However, reports on pregnant women infected with SARS-CoV-2 were very limited. By sharing the clinical characteristics, treatments and outcomes of 18 patients with COVID-19 during late pregnancy, we hope to provide some references for obstetric treatment and management.

METHODS

A total of 18 patients with COVID-19 treated at Renmin Hospital of Wuhan University were collected. The epidemiological characteristics, clinical manifestations, laboratory tests, chest CT and pregnancy outcomes were performed for analysis.

RESULTS

  1. 18 cases of late pregnancy infected with SARS-CoV-2 pneumonia were delivered at 35 weeks to 41 weeks. According to the clinical classification of COVID-19, 1 case was mild type, 16 cases were ordinary type, and 1 case was severe type. 2. According to imaging examinations: 15 (83%) cases showed unilateral or bilateral pneumonia, 2 (11%) cases had pulmonary infection with pleural effusion, and 1 (6%) case had no abnormal imaging changes. 8 (44%) cases were positive and 10 (56%) cases were negative for nasopharyngeal-swab tests of SARS-CoV-2. 3. Among the 18 newborns, there were 3 (17%) premature infants, 1 (6%) case of mild asphyxia, 5 (28%) cases of bacterial pneumonia, 1 (6%) case of gastrointestinal bleeding, 1 (6%) case of necrotizing enteritis, 2 (11%) cases of hyperbilirubinemia and 1 (6%) case of diarrhea. All the newborns were negative for the first throat swab test of SARS-CoV-2 after birth. 4. Follow-up to Mar 7, 2020, no maternal and neonatal deaths occurred.

CONCLUSIONS

The majority of patients in late term pregnancy with COVID-19 were of ordinary type, and they were less likely to develop into critical pneumonia after early isolation and antiviral treatment. Vertical transmission of SARS-CoV-2 was not detected, but the proportion of neonatal bacterial pneumonia was higher than other neonatal diseases in newborns.

摘要

背景

与严重急性呼吸综合征(SARS)和中东呼吸综合征(MERS)相比,2019 年冠状病毒病(COVID-19)传播更快、更广。人群普遍易感。然而,关于感染 SARS-CoV-2 的孕妇的报告非常有限。通过分享 18 例妊娠晚期 COVID-19 患者的临床特征、治疗方法和结局,我们希望为产科治疗和管理提供一些参考。

方法

收集了在武汉大学人民医院治疗的 18 例 COVID-19 妊娠晚期患者。对其流行病学特征、临床表现、实验室检查、胸部 CT 和妊娠结局进行分析。

结果

  1. 18 例妊娠晚期感染 SARS-CoV-2 肺炎的患者在 35 周至 41 周分娩。根据 COVID-19 的临床分类,轻度 1 例,普通型 16 例,重型 1 例。2. 根据影像学检查:单侧或双侧肺炎 15 例(83%),肺炎合并胸腔积液 2 例(11%),无异常影像学改变 1 例(6%)。鼻咽拭子 SARS-CoV-2 检测阳性 8 例(44%),阴性 10 例(56%)。3. 18 例新生儿中,早产儿 3 例(17%),轻度窒息 1 例(6%),细菌性肺炎 5 例(28%),胃肠道出血 1 例(6%),坏死性小肠结肠炎 1 例(6%),高胆红素血症 2 例(11%),腹泻 1 例(6%)。所有新生儿出生后首次咽拭子 SARS-CoV-2 检测均为阴性。4. 截至 2020 年 3 月 7 日随访,母婴均未死亡。

结论

妊娠晚期 COVID-19 患者多为普通型,早期隔离抗病毒治疗后,不易发展为危重型肺炎。未检测到 SARS-CoV-2 的垂直传播,但新生儿细菌性肺炎的比例高于其他新生儿疾病。
